In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
watchdog: unregister PM notifier on watchdog unregister
watchdog_register_device() registers wdd->pm_nb when WDOG_NO_PING_ON_SUSPEND is set, but watchdog_unregister_device() does not remove it. This leaves an embedded notifier block on the PM notifier chain after the watchdog device has been unregistered.
A later suspend/resume notification can then call watchdog_pm_notifier() with a stale watchdog_device pointer, or at minimum after wdd->wd_data has been cleared by watchdog_dev_unregister().
Unregister the PM notifier before tearing down the watchdog device.
